Plano, the closest town, has to do with 14.6 kilometres away. Bowling Environment-friendly covers a total location of 105.28 sq. kilometres, of which 104.61 sq. km is occupied by land, and 0.67 sq. km is covered by water. According to Kppen Environment Classification, Bowling Green experiences a humid subtropical climate. It is usually rainy and partly gloomy, with warm, damp summer seasons and short, extremely chilly winters months.




Generally, it receives 6 inches of snow every year and 50 inches of rain yearly. The year's most popular month is July, and the hot season lasts for 3 - Bowling Green location.8 months, with an average daily heat exceeding 80F. January is the year's chilliest month having an average low of 29F and a high of 45F

Content credit score: Jantira Namwong/ Robert and George Moore established Bowling Eco-friendly in 1780, and history has it that their sporting activity of bowling wood balls across an eco-friendly is what offered the city its name. The Moore siblings gave 2 acres of land the list below year so that Warren Area might build a lumber courthouse and jail.

The settlers selected Bowling Environment-friendly as the name and designation for the new city at the initial area commissioners' conference in very early 1798. This name was motivated by the Bowling Green Square in New York City, where throughout the American Change, patriots toppled a sculpture of King George III and used the result in produce bullets.


The city's populace is presently rising at a rate of 1.93% annual. White (Non-Hispanic) (70.4%), Black or African American (Non-Hispanic) (12.7%), Asian (Non-Hispanic) (4.92%), White (Hispanic) (4.39%), and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(3.21%) are the five major ethnic groups in the city. In Bowling Eco-friendly, where the hardship rate is 25.89%, the average household earnings is $61,314.


The average age is 27, with 27 for guys and 27.1 for ladies.
